WebApr 30, 2024 · Rennet is derived from the cleaned, frozen, salted, or dried fourth stomachs (abomasa) of calves, lambs, or goats. Bovine rennet is derived from adult cows, sheep, or goats. 1 Calf rennet is the most … WebAnimal rennet is a combination of enzymes that are produced in the stomachs of certain mammals. The main component is chymosin, which, along with other enzymes, curdles the milk. WebJan 31, 2024 · And rennet is a must in order to classify as a true Parmigiano Reggiano cheese, along with cow's milk and salt, according to the European Union's legal definition.
WebMay 10, 2024 · If it makes you feel any better, those stomachs play a crucial role in making Parmesan cheese what it is, thanks to the ability of chymosin to separate solids from liquids in the cheesemaking process. When producing Parmesan, rennet is introduced after unpasteurized cow's milk is heated, in order to start the separation process. WebRennet is an enzyme used to set cheese during the making process. Stirred into a vat of cultured milk, it causes the milk to coagulate and separate into solids (curds) and liquid (whey). The curds are turned into cheese. There are two main types of rennet, animal rennet and vegetarian rennet.
WebFeb 3, 2024 · Raw cow's milk is gently heated in large copper kettles or vats. Natural whey and rennet are added to trigger coagulation and curd formation. The curd is separated and placed in molds, and the whey is drained. The molds are then brined and aged.
